7 Things to Pack When You Travel

New Year, new plans, hopefully a lot of traveling for all of you.



Before every trip the question always comes up, what are key things what you need to have in your backpack?

What can’t you leave at home?

1. Extra money on a credit card - with credit card you can almost pay everywhere for everything, much more safe and practical than carrying tons of cash – the amount depends on what kind of trip you are going.
In the 99% of the cases you will not need this, because luckily there will not be an unexpected/emergency situation, and at the end you will have some extra money, which you can use to make some special memories (still unexpected event, but a positive one)

2. Your hobby - especially for longer trips, it’s a good idea to take with you the thing what makes you relaxed at home. It will help you to connect yourself with the new environment.

3. Travel book (Lonely planet) - first it can look like a lame thing, but it’s not at all. In some countries you have to be prepared that maybe you won’t reach the 4G internet. At the end it will have an emotional connection with you and with the trip

4. One book/ebook - trips are not always about endless action, you will stay a lot of times at airports/train stations/bus station and other stations, or just rest in your bed. In this situation its very useful, and somehow the trip has an effect on the book itself and how it affects you.

5. Tour sandals - yes.yes.yes. "How will I look like?? Nooo!!!"
Who cares!? It’s the most practical thing ever. For hiking, city tour, beaches, you can use it everywhere. Small, easy to clean, you can use it everywhere and durable...and ugly, but still, who cares? You are on a trip, not on a ball.  The mountain tribes will give a 100% shit about what kind of shoes you wear.

6. Half of the cloths you would think - takes a lots of space, its heavy and most of the time totally for nothing. Check the weather of your destination, add an extra pullover and then just leave the half of the cloths at home that you prepared to take with you.

7. One towel - you always need one towel.
